Elden Ring Reported To Topple Total Of Game Of The Year Awards Previously Helmed By The Last Of Us Part II

When it came to 2022’s Game of the Year award, it would be a tough decision this year. In The Game Awards’ nomination list, it included A Plague Tale: Requiem, Elden Ring, God of War Ragnarok, Horizon Forbidden West, Stray, and Xenoblade Chronicles 3. Came the ending of the show in December, it was revealed FromSoftware’s Elden Ring took the award.

In our review for the game, Rectify Gaming also boasted the potential for the game to be in the nominations for the award way back at the start of 2022. “When I say that Elden Ring has quickly become one of my favorite games of all time, I am not exaggerating that fact. It has all the best elements of my favorite games in one package,” writes critic Michael Merchant.

Recently, a ResetEra post online has surfaced bringing a lot of chatter about the extensive praise for Elden Ring. In that, user a0mineda1k1 created a tracking site for total awards provided for Game of the Year and the latest winner has surpassed the previous holder for most awards. Before, Naughty Dog’s The Last of Us Part II held that place after dethroning CD projekt Red’s The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t.

However, Elden Ring is now said to be in that position. According to the aforementioned website, Elden Ring currently sits at a total 362 awards. In comparison, 2020’s The Last of Us Part II is measured with 322 awards. Noted, the counting is still in progress for Elden Ring and a future update could further place Elden Ring ahead than currently.
